js循环数组用逗号拼接 JavaScript循环数组拼接
JavaScript是一门非常常用的脚本语言,它有着广泛的应用场景。在Web开发中,我们经常会遇到将数组元素拼接成字符串的需求,而其中一种常见的拼接方式就是使用逗号进行分隔。那么,在JavaScript中如何实现这样的功能呢?接下来,我将为大家详细介绍。
首先,我们需要明确一点:JavaScript提供了多种方法来操作数组和字符串。其中,最常见的两种方式是使用for循环和Array的join方法。下面,我们将分别介绍这两种方式。
1. 使用for循环进行拼接:
```javascript
var arr ['apple', 'banana', 'orange'];
var result '';
for (var i 0; i < arr.length; i ) {
result arr[i];
if (i ! arr.length - 1) {
result ',';
}
}
console.log(result);
```
上述代码中,我们首先定义了一个空字符串result,然后使用for循环遍历数组arr的每个元素,并将其逐个拼接到result中。在每个元素后面添加逗号,除了最后一个元素外。
2. 使用Array的join方法进行拼接:
```javascript
var arr ['apple', 'banana', 'orange'];
var result (',');
console.log(result);
```
上述代码中,我们直接使用数组arr的join方法,传入逗号作为参数,即可实现将数组元素用逗号拼接成字符串的操作。
这两种方式都有各自的优势和适用场景。使用for循环更加灵活,可以根据具体需求进行定制化的拼接操作;而使用Array的join方法虽然简洁,但不够灵活,适用于简单的拼接场景。
至此,我们已经学会了在JavaScript中使用循环数组将元素用逗号拼接的方法。希望本文对大家有所帮助。如果还有其他相关问题,欢迎留言讨论。
JavaScript 循环数组 逗号拼接 字符串拼接 数组拼接 数组转字符串
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。